A relay proxy is a server or software component that intercepts network traffic between clients and servers, forwarding requests and responses on behalf of the client. This intermediary role allows organizations to enforce security policies, such as encrypting data, filtering content, and monitoring traffic for threats. Relay proxies are commonly used to protect sensitive information, ensure compliance with regulations, and provide an additional layer of anonymity for users. By acting as a gatekeeper, a relay proxy helps prevent direct access to internal networks, reducing the risk of cyberattacks and unauthorized data exposure.
